The best time to visit bolivia like most of its south american neighbors, bolivia’s climate varies based on altitude and season, making it a great destination throughout the whole year. The best months for outdoor adventures are may through august when the chance of rain is minuscule.

May to october rainy season: The dry season is high season in bolivia as crystal clear skies and a distinct lack of rain allow tourists to hike and climb to their heart’s content. However, the rainy season from late november until beginning of april brings with it great opportunities for keen photographers, especially when visiting altiplano and salar de uyuni.
